Jenna Ortega is the newest global ambassador for adidas. The brand launched an all-new label, adidas Sportswear, with the Wednesday actress front and center as its face.

The new label—the brand's first in five decades—will launch online and in stores on Feb. 9. The athleisure collection will feature pieces that can easily be mixed and matched for a unique and sporty style.

The partnership was unveiled in a joint post by the adidas and adidas women official Instagram accounts on Feb. 1. “Welcome to the \\\ @jennaortega,” read the caption.

In the photo, Ortega wore a striped purple, black and white adidas Sportswear top paired with matching pants and tennis shoes from the new label’s spring-summer 2023 collection.

The 20-year-old acknowledged the partnership in an IG story of her own. She reshared the above pic and wrote, “So excited to be joining the @adidas family!!”

In an official press release, Ortega shared that she loves to express herself through the clothing she wears.

“I am huge advocate of expressing all your different pursuits, passions and traits, whether that is through what you do, what you wear or what you champion—which is why I was so excited to work with adidas on this new label,” she stated of the partnership.

The colorful collection is a bit of a departure from Ortega’s on-screen personality as Wednesday Addams in the hit Netflix series. Ortega joked in an interview with Yahoo! that since she’s “living in black” these days, she’s been inspired to wear more color.

“I would get dressed in the dark in [the new adidas Sportswear] collection and it would still make sense and would still feel good and I feel like people would still compliment me on the outfit,” she said.
